Thus, we can say that the ionic strength of an ionic compound can be calculated as half of the sum of products of the molar concentration of the ions and the square of their respective charges. the factor of 1 2 comes from the fact that the ionic compound dissociates into cations and anions. In theoretical chemistry, ionic strength is used to calculate salt dissociation in heterogeneous systems like colloids. it’s also used in biochemistry and molecular biology to determine the strength of buffer solutions with concentrations that should be close to those found in nature. For a 1:1 electrolyte such as 0.1 m naclo 4 the ionic strength is equal to the molarity of the electrolyte. for a 2:1 electrolyte (e.g. 0.1m cacl 2), i = 0.5 [0.1 m ( 2) 2 0.2 m (1) 2] = 0.3 m. normally the ionic strength is maintained using naclo 4, as clo 4− is a weakly coordinating anion.
